Although low-molecular weight protein tyrosines phosphatase (LMW-PTP) has been associated with tumorigenesis and tumor progression, its role is controversial. In this study, we show that alterations in the RhoA activation status caused by knocking-down separately the two main isoforms of LMW-PTP, fast and slow, interfere with the migratory potential of breast cancer cells. Our results highlight the differential role of LMW-PTP isoforms in cancer biology.
